What is an associate manager?

An associate manager oversees employees at a company or organization to help improve productivity and performance. These management professionals may work in a variety of departments, such as quality assurance or marketing. As an associate manager, your job duties include training, directing, and evaluating workers. You may also provide progress reports to higher management and perform administrative tasks as needed. Although the career qualifications vary depending on the employer, you typically need a bachelor’s degree in business administration or a related field and prior management experience. You should also have excellent interpersonal, communication, and leadership skills.

What are some common challenges associate managers face when transitioning from individual contributor roles to management?

Associate Managers often encounter challenges such as balancing their own workload with new leadership responsibilities, learning to delegate tasks effectively, and developing communication skills to manage diverse team members. Adapting to giving constructive feedback and handling team conflicts can also be new territory. Many find that building trust within the team and shifting focus from personal achievements to team success are key aspects of this transition.

What is the difference between Associate Manager vs Project Coordinator?

AspectAssociate ManagerProject Coordinator
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ree, management experience often preferredBachelor's degree, entry-level or related certifications
Work EnvironmentSupervises teams, manages projects, strategic planningSupports project execution, coordinates tasks, communicates with teams
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in corporate, retail, and service industriesUsed across various industries for project support roles

The main difference between an Associate Manager and a Project Coordinator lies in their responsibilities and level of authority. An Associate Manager typically oversees teams, manages projects, and participates in strategic planning, requiring more experience and leadership skills. In contrast, a Project Coordinator focuses on supporting project execution by coordinating tasks and facilitating communication. Both roles are essential in organizational workflows but differ in scope and seniority.

What is an associate manager?

An Associate Manager is a mid-level supervisory position typically responsible for assisting in the management of a team, department, or business unit. They support senior managers by overseeing daily operations, guiding employees, implementing company policies, and helping achieve organizational goals. Associate Managers often serve as a bridge between staff and upper management, ensuring clear communication and effective workflow. This role can be found in a variety of industries, including retail, finance, and hospitality.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ate manager?

To thrive as an Associate Manager, you need strong leadership, organizational, and problem-solving skills, often backed by a bachelor’s deg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with project management tools, data analysis software,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ems is typically required. Exceptional communication, adaptability, and team collaboration are vital soft skills that help you motivate and guide staff. These abilities are important to effectively oversee daily operations, drive team performance, and achieve organizational goals.

Description & Requirements
Job Description
Warehouse Associate
We are in search of a Warehouse Associate to join our growing team. The Warehouse Associate is responsible for performing a variety of tasks to support daily warehouse operations. This includes receiving, stocking, picking, packing, inventory management and facility maintenance. The role supports the flow of products to and from inventory while maintaining a commitment to safety, quality, and customer service.
Responsibilities Include:
  • Accurately pull and process customer orders for delivery and shipping, including labeling and documentation.
  • Receive, stock, and rotate products; participate in audits, cycle counts, and annual inventory.
  • Load and unload trucks.
  • Operate warehouse equipment as required and after proper training, such as pallet jacks or forklifts.
  • Assist with warehouse facility and equipment maintenance.
  • Maintain a clean and organized workspace and warehouse.
  • Communicate effectively with team members and management, attend department meetings, and contribute to a positive work environment.
  • Abide by all safety and compliance protocols, ensuring a safe work environment.
  • Take personal ownership of all customer needs with speed and urgency.
  • Additional duties as assigned.

The Ideal Candidate Will Have:
  • Previous warehouse, logistics, or inventory experience preferred; however, entry level candidates are welcome to apply
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Prior forklift certification preferred, or ability to obtain upon hire
  • Ability to operate warehouse equipment such as pallet jacks, pickers, or scrubbers
  • Basic computer skills to operate warehouse management systems, tools such as scanners, and data entry tasks
  • Basic math skills to manage inventory counts and measurements (addition, subtraction, multiplication, division)
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ment, meet deadlines and work overtime as needed
  • Physical Requirements: While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required lift up to 50lbs and push/pull 100lbs. Ability to walk, climb, kneel, stoop, and balance frequently
